Summary:
The Photography and Content Intern will assist the Bucks photographers in curation, logging, post-production, content creation & capturing the excitement, emotion, and fun around the Milwaukee Bucks. The ideal candidate will be responsible for logging game night photos, working with the content team to identify unique and compelling photography and supplementary video content, to be distributed across various Milwaukee Bucks digital platforms. They will also aid in creating and curating content for year-round engagement across the organization’s digital audience.
Responsibilities:
- Perform multiple duties during games, including card running, live ingestion of photos, captioning and key wording photos, editing photos, photo gear transport, lighting assistance, and any other photo or video needs deemed necessary.
- Color correct all images for use in print, web, and social media materials.
- Input metadata on all images with photo captioning, naming, and tagging for future searching capabilities.
- Fulfill internal photo requests from Marketing, Digital, Corporate Sales, Ticket Sales.
- Assist in managing photo archives, including editing, tagging, cataloging, and scanning all current/historical imagery.
- Capture and edit video for secondary Bucks social media accounts.
- Assist the Creative and Content teams as needed.
